Web* Rhythmic activity (i.e., faster notes) = more intensity; slower notes = less intensity * Strong and weak beats of meter Melodic contour The "typical" phrase starts lower in pitch, rises to a high point, and ends on a lower pitch. Consider: * Melodic direction /progression * Large vs. small melodic leaps

WebA motive is a compositional tool. It’s an idea that the musician repeats at various times, either in its basic forms or in developed formats. The motive is what gives a composition its distinctive character and mood.
